By AAP Victoria Derby favourite Thinkin’ Big has continued preparations for the $2 million Classic with a course proper gallop at Flemington. Thinkin’ Big galloped alongside stablemate Shumookh in a hit-out on Tuesday morning with co-trainer Gai Waterhouse watching from the grandstand.
